SD Democratic Attorney General Candidate Randy Seiler Files Campaign Complaint

Democratic Attorney General candidate Randy Seiler has filed a complaint with the Government Accountability Board against the head of the Department of Public Safety, Trevor Jones.
Seiler says he deserves a hearing…..

The complaint is connected to an appearance by republican Attorney General Candidate Jason Ravnsborg at a Department of Public Safety demonstration at the State Fair. Jones apologized for allowing Ravnsborg to appear.

Seiler says there could be a violation of the state employee handbook….

Seiler says it is difficult to make up for the public appearance…..

The Government Accountability Board meets on an irregular schedule to hear these type of cases.
